Present research or technical information

Work activity · O*NET

Present research or technical information is an intermediate work activity in the O*NET database — a concrete task that recurs across many occupations , grouped under Documenting/Recording Information. 125 occupations report doing it as part of their work.

What it involves

The most common detailed activities O*NET records under this category, ranked by how many occupation tasks map to each.

  • Prepare scientific or technical reports or presentations
  • Write reports or evaluations
  • Prepare research or technical reports
  • Present medical research reports
  • Present research results to others
  • Prepare analytical reports
  • Prepare technical or operational reports
  • Prepare technical reports for internal use

How AI is applied to this activity

Microsoft's "Working with AI" study mapped real Bing Copilot conversations to O*NET work activities. The figures below are their measurements for this activity — they describe how AI is used today in one assistant's data, not a forecast that the activity will be automated.

AI completes it successfully 90.4% When Copilot attempts this activity, how often it finishes the task
Scope AI handles 59.4% How much of the activity AI carries within a conversation
Positive user feedback 67.7% Share of interactions users rated positively
How often AI is applied here 98th pct Percentile across all measured activities by how often AI performs them

Source: Microsoft "Working with AI" (working-with-ai). A high completion rate means AI can assist the activity in isolation — it does not mean an occupation that performs it is being automated, since every job blends many activities.
